Responsibilities
- Patient Assessment: Evaluate patients' physical conditions, including mobility, strength, and flexibility.
- Treatment and Education: Provide therapeutic exercises, manual therapy, and other treatments to enhance functionality and alleviate pain. Educate patients and families on exercises, posture, and body mechanics to aid recovery, prevent injuries, and offer guidance on home routines and lifestyle changes.
- Documentation: Maintain accurate records of evaluations, progress, and treatment plans, ensuring compliance with legal and ethical standards.
- Collaboration: Work with healthcare providers to ensure effective patient care and participate in multidisciplinary team meetings as needed.
Qualifications
- Education: Degree in Physical Therapy from an accredited institution.
- Licensure: Valid state licensure as a Physical Therapist, or license eligible
- Skills: Strong clinical assessment and diagnostic skills. Proficient in developing and implementing effective treatment plans.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with a patient-centered approach.
- Physical Requirements: Ability to lift and assist patients as needed. Must be able to stand for extended periods and perform physical tasks related to therapy.

Inpatient physical therapists primarily manage patients within hospitals or nursing facilities, focusing on early mobilization and acute care rehabilitation. This contrasts with outpatient roles where patients attend therapy sessions regularly but live independently. The inpatient setting demands rapid assessment and interdisciplinary coordination.
Key abilities include thorough patient evaluation, hands-on manual therapy, and strong communication to educate patients and families. Expertise in mobility enhancement and pain management tailored to inpatient needs ensures better recovery trajectories and aligns with employer expectations like those at Healthpro Heritage.
